Data Analyst Co-Op
Job Description
- Assist in designing data architecture and organizing data from manufacturing and global service partners, as well as front end ordering systems
- Develop and implement automated routines for data collection, pre-processing, and integrity checks in preparation for analysis
- Collaborate with research and data science teams to perform exploratory data analytics, identifying trends and data features
- Contribute to planning and road mapping new features and functionality
- Support multi-disciplinary agile teams in developing and improving AI models
- Create reports and metrics to drive more efficient initiatives
- Document and present progress/results to stakeholders and other teams
- Assist with other project activities as assigned
